Position Deviation Window

Description

The position deviation window allows you to monitor whether the motor is within a parameterizable position deviation.

The position deviation is the difference between reference position and actual position.

The position deviation window comprises position deviation and monitoring time.

The parameters MON_p_DiffWin_usr and MON_ChkTime specify the size of the window.

Status Indication

The status is available via a signal output.

In order to read the status via a signal output, you must first parameterize the signal output function “In Position Deviation Window”, see chapter Digital Inputs and Outputs.

The parameter MON_ChkTime acts on the parameters MON_p_DiffWin_usr (MON_p_DiffWin), MON_v_DiffWin, MON_v_Threshold and MON_I_Threshold.

Monitoring of time window.

Adjustment of a time for monitoring of position deviation, velocity deviation, velocity value and current value. If the monitored value is in the permissible range during the adjusted time, the monitoring function delivers a positive result.
